Resume for Carpenter in Sale

Carpentery is a highly skilled job that requires precision, focus on detail, and years of knowledge. A well-crafted resume can enable carpenters to show their expertise and help them secure lucrative employment opportunities. In this post, we’ll help you with the process of creating an effective resume for a carpenter.

1. Personal Information

Contact Details

Make sure to include on your resume your complete name, telephone number and email address. It is important to ensure that these details are up-to-date and easily accessible.

Objective Statement

Write a brief objective statement that outlines your career goals as carpenter. Customize it for the particular job or industry you’re applying for.

Example: Highly skilled carpenter with more than 10 years experience, looking to make use of my woodworking skills within a fast-growing construction firm.

2. Professional Summary

This section should you should summarize your{ overall|| entire} experience as a carpenter and highlight any particular skills or accomplishments that make you stand against other candidates.

Example: A versatile and detail-oriented carpenter with a proven track record of delivering quality craftsmanship in both residential and commercial projects. Proficient in various woodworking techniques such as frame work, cabinetry and finishing work. Strong problem-solving abilities combined with an excellent communication skill allow me to work effectively both on my own and as part of as part of a team.

3. Skills

Include the most important skills that are applicable to the field of carpentry. Include technical skills such as:

  • Skills in the use of hand equipment and power tools
  • The ability to master different woodworking techniques
  • Ability to read blueprints and interpret the design plans
  • Expertise in cutting, measuring, and cutting wood materials
  • Knowledge of safety procedures and the regulations for carpentry

Be sure to list any special capabilities or qualifications you hold that distinguish you from the other candidates.

4. Work Experience

Incorporate your prior work experience for carpenter emphasizing your most important accomplishments and responsibilities. Include the name of your employer, your job title as well as dates of your employment and an outline of your responsibilities.

Example:

Carpenter – ABC Construction Company | January 2015 – Present

  • Built and installed custom cabinets for residential customers Working closely with designers to bring their visions to life.
  • Completed multiple renovation projects within the timeframes specified while maintaining high-quality standards.
  • Collaborated with other tradespeople on the construction site to assure smooth work flow and respect for deadlines for projects.

Write down each job experience with reverse chronological order starting with the most recent position.

5. Education

This section should mention your education background that is related to carpentry. Include the name of your institution, the degree/diploma you received (if relevant) and the date of your completion.

Example:

Diploma in Carpentry – XYZ Technical Institute | May 2012

6. Certifications and Training

If you’ve taken part in specific training programs or have obtained any certifications that directly relate to carpentry, you should list the details at the bottom of this list. This will demonstrate your commitment toward professional development and ongoing education within the field.

Example:

OSHA Certified: Completed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) course of instruction on safety procedures for construction.

FAQ

How can I make an impressive resume for a job as a carpenter job?

Crafting an effective resume for a job as a carpenter demands attention to detail as well as highlighting relevant skills and experiences. Here are some ideas to help you craft an impactful carpenter resume:

  1. Modify the content Your resume can be customized to fit the requirements of the position the job you’re seeking. Include relevant experiences or skills as well as qualifications.
  2. Include a professional summary Write a succinct introduction at the top in your resume. It will help you introduce yourself and grab the attention of potential employers. Focus on showcasing your key skills as a carpenter.
  3. Highlight your technical abilities: Emphasize your proficiency with carpentry tools equipment, techniques, and materials. Include keywords related to different types of carpentry work you’re familiar with (e.g., framing, finish carpentry woodworking).
  4. Present the previous projects include the section devoted to highlighting notable projects or achievements in your career as carpenter. Define the scope of the project, the role you played, and any tangible outcomes or results.
  5. Include any certifications or training: If you have been awarded any certifications or training related to carpentry, be certain to mention them. This could include safety certifications or specialized training programs or apprenticeships.

Which format do I need to use for my carpenter resume?

When it comes to choosing a format for your carpenter resume, it’s important to keep it clean, professional-looking, and easy-to-read for hiring managers. There are two standard designs that are great for resumes:

  1. The Chronological Format This format highlights your professional background by presenting it in reverse chronological order (starting with the most recent job). It is a great option if have a solid background as a carpenter, and you want to show continuous career growth.
  2. Functional format This format focuses on your abilities and achievements, instead of focusing on particular dates or job names. It’s a good choice if have transferable skills, are transitioning careers, or have gaps in your job background.

Select the one that best matches your specific situation. Also, ensure that your resume is consistent across all sections. Consider using the combination of both formats to highlight the carpentry skills and experience you have acquired.

How can I make my Carpenter resume stand out?

To make your carpenter resume stand out among the others take these steps:

  1. Qualify your accomplishments: Whenever possible make sure to include specific numbers percents, or measurements to highlight your accomplishments as carpenter. For instance, you could mention the number of construction projects you completed successfully or how much savings you realized through your work.
  2. Utilize action verbs Start bullet points describing your previous job responsibilities with strong action verbs to enhance their appeal and memorable. Verbs such as "built, " "installed, " "created, " and "managed" display dynamism and proficiency.
  3. Include industry-specific keywords: Tailor your resume by including relevant keywords from the industry related to the carpentry field. Check job descriptions for commonly used phrases or terms and use them on your resume if suitable. This will help you get interest of managers who are hiring or applicants tracking system (ATS).
  4. Include Portfolio If you are able you can provide a link or mention that you have a portfolio showcasing photos of past carpentry projects or detailed descriptions of your most notable projects. The visual evidence will help to demonstrate the excellence of your craftsmanship.
  5. Be sure to proofread it carefully Make sure you eliminate any errors in grammar or typos from your resume by proofreading your resume multiple times. Errors can leave a negative impression on prospective employers and decrease the effectiveness of an otherwise strong application.

Should I put references on my resume for carpenter?

Include references on your resume are no longer mandatory or a standard method. Instead, you can use the area on your resume to provide other relevant information.

However, it’s a good idea to have a separate list of professional references ready to provide to employers on request. It is important to ensure that the references you provide are those who can talk about your{ skills,| abilities,|| capabilities,} character, and abilities as carpenter. Include their names, jobs titles, contact information, and an explanation of how you work with them (e.g. an ex-supervisor, former supervisor or a employee).

When you list references, be sure to inform your contacts beforehand and ensure they are willing to act as references for you. Additionally, keep your list of references current to ensure that any changes are made.
